I emailed you, but for the sake of public history, here's roughly what I said:

There are two issues for me at the moment:

  • How to do training from Python in an informative and useful way.
  • How to serialize and deserialize models at runtime.

I think the second problem can be solved if we changed how Pico builds its models to a method that involves proper deserialization. Then it would be much simpler to load different Pico models (perhaps for different objects) at runtime, rather than requiring them to be pre-compiled. Perhaps something like Google ProtoBuf/Cap'n'proto or Boost.serialize?

For training, I'm afraid I don't know at all. Do you think it would be simple to make is so you can just pass a set of images (uint8 buffers) for positive and negative and it will (maybe days later) drop a model out?

Let us talk about the easier issue first: How to serialize and deserialize models at runtime.

I can write an interface to the detector which would let you pass the classification cascade itself instead of a pointer to the function which performs classification.

I think that would satisfy your needs. Please provide further input.

Yes I think that is a good start. The main question is just what the format of that model is going to be - will you make some form of struct that gets passed into the function? If so, we just need to decide what is the best method to actually efficiently serialize the model to disk and read it back in again. Especially since this method should obviously be portable and cross-platform and ideally simple to perform through a Python-C bridge.
